The values of ALPHA and DELTA determine the robustness of the delineation  
method. ALPHA determines the robustness against false misalignments due to  
bit errors. DELTA determines the robustness against false delineation in the  
synchronization process. ALPHA is chosen to be 7 and DELTA is chosen to be  
6.  
The loss of cell delineation (LCD) alarm is declared after 1318 consecutive cell  
periods (4.0 ms at 155.52Mb/s) in the HUNT or PRESYNC states. The LCD  
alarm is cleared after 1318 consecutive cells in the SYNC state.  
All cells with an incorrect HCS octet are filtered out and counted. Header  
correction is not performed.
